How should a user verify if their visual voicemail is working?

To verify if visual voicemail is functioning properly, a user should check settings in the voicemail app. This option is the most relevant because visual voicemail is a feature that can be directly assessed within the settings of the voicemail application itself. Within the app, users can see if their voicemails are being received and accessed correctly, as well as review configurations that enable visual voicemail, including the setup of their voicemail box.

Using alternative methods like dialing their phone number or texting the voicemail box may not provide a clear assessment of whether visual voicemail as a feature is operational. Dialing the phone number might lead to hearing voicemail messages but won't confirm if the visual voicemail interface is functioning as intended. Similarly, sending a text to the voicemail box doesn't pertain to checking the operational status of visual voicemail features. Therefore, checking the voicemail app settings is the most straightforward and effective method to ensure that visual voicemail is working properly.
